Still not received Season Ticket

by TadleyDave » 22 Aug 2017 11:30

Been supporting Reading since 1959 and been a season ticket holder since 2001-2002 season but this season has been a disaster in that myself,wife & daughter still haven't received our new season tickets,just wondering how widespread this is.I have to keep ringing the ticket office to find out where they are and have had to use paper tickets for the three games that we have attended this season,for tonight's game we have to collect them from the ticket office.

I did enquire if the points that we would have got by entering the stadium for matches can be claimed back but the answer I got was a waste of time,so anyone else still waiting for theirs?
